dict的特性dict是python中的一个可变的数据类型,用{}表示,dict的key必须是不可变的数据类型,而value的数据类型可以任意。格式:{key:value,key:value,key:value}注: 键值对如果是字符串使用单引号,最后一个键值对没有逗号dict的优点①:查询速度快,可以二分查找②:key是不可以重复的注:不可变数据类型: 元组,bool,int , str 可以h
def writeCsv(File,species): row = [File,species] out = open("data/test.csv", "a", newline="") csv_writer = csv.writer(out, dialect="excel") csv_writer.writerow(row) #若想在csv文件第一行加标题 wri
转载 2023-06-28 20:59:42
161阅读
# Python CSV 列表数据写到列的实现 在数据处理和管理的过程中,CSV(Comma-Separated Values)格式是一种非常常用的文件格式。它通过逗号分隔字段,能够以表格的形式存储数据,非常适合用来存储和交换数据。在这篇文章中,我们将学习如何将一组列表数据写入CSV文件的列中。整个过程包括几个步骤,让我们一起来看一下这个流程。 ## 整个流程概述 下面是整个流程的概述,包含
原创 2024-08-28 03:34:46
60阅读
# Python将多行数据写入CSV文件 在数据处理和分析过程中,我们经常需要将多行数据写入CSV文件中。CSV(Comma-Separated Values)是一种常见的数据格式,它使用逗号来分隔不同的字段。Python提供了csv模块来帮助我们方便地处理CSV文件。 ## CSV文件格式 CSV文件通常由多行数据组成,每行数据由多个字段组成,字段之间使用逗号进行分隔。例如,下面是一个简单
原创 2024-05-24 05:49:10
99阅读
# 使用Apache Spark 读写CSV文件到Hudi的全面指南 在大数据处理领域,Apache Spark和Apache Hudi是两个备受欢迎的技术。Spark是一种快速且通用的分布式计算引擎,而Hudi则是一个用于管理大规模数据集的框架,支持高效的读写操作。本文将介绍如何使用Spark读取CSV文件并将其写入Hudi,同时提供示例代码和流程图。 ## 1. 环境准备 在开始之前,我
原创 2024-10-27 06:33:11
74阅读
# 写入CSV文件下一行数据的方法 在实际的开发中,有时候我们需要将数据写入CSV文件,并且每次写入数据时都要写到文件的下一行。在Python中,我们可以使用`csv`模块来实现这个功能。下面我们将介绍如何使用Python来写入CSV文件的下一行数据。 ## 实际问题 假设我们有一个学生成绩的CSV文件,每行记录学生的姓名、年龄和成绩。我们现在需要向这个文件中继续添加学生的成绩数据,每次添加
原创 2024-04-02 06:21:45
86阅读
## Python如何将列表中的元素写入CSV文件 CSV(Comma-Separated Values)是一种常见的以逗号分隔数据的文件格式,常用于数据交换和存储。Python提供了多种方法来将列表中的元素写入CSV文件。本文将介绍使用标准库csv和pandas库实现的两种方法,并附有代码示例。 ### 使用标准库csv实现 首先,我们需要导入csv模块,并创建一个CSV文件对象。然后,我
原创 2023-08-23 11:54:12
449阅读
简单实现,代码如下:import csv # 1.创建文件对象 f = open('csv_file.csv', 'w', encoding='utf-8') # 2.基于文件对象构建csv写入对象 csv_write = csv.writer(f) # 3.构建列表头 csv_write.writerow(['学号', '班级', '姓名']) # 4.写入csv文件 csv_w
CSV 文件格式描述逗号分隔值(Comma-Separated Values,CSV,有时成为字符分隔值)。其文件以纯文本形式存储表格数据(数字和文本),文件的每一行都是一个数据记录。每个记录由一个或多个字段组成,用逗号分隔。使用逗号作为字段分隔符是此文件格式的名称的来源,因为分隔字符也可以不是逗号,有时也称为字符分隔值。CSV 广泛用于不同体系结构的应用程序之间交换数据表格信息,解决不兼容数据格
# Python中的字典 在Python这门编程语言中,字典(dictionary)是一种非常重要的数据结构,它允许我们将数据以键值对的形式存储和访问。字典在Python中是一种无序的集合,其中每个元素都由一个键和一个值组成。字典是Python中非常强大和灵活的数据结构之一,它可以用来表示各种不同类型的数据关系。 ## 字典的基本用法 在Python中,我们可以使用大括号 `{}` 来创建一
原创 2024-04-16 03:50:47
26阅读
内容来自对 chatgpt 的咨询 csv 格式 csv 格式的文件使用 wps 或者 office 打开后是一个 excel 表格的形式,很容易看到表格
原创 2023-11-15 11:48:43
313阅读
我们平时在项目中都是用Spring来管理的,那么,Spring是如何管理MyBatis的呢?我们来一探究竟。编程式加载MyBatis要了解Spring是如何加载MyBatis的,我想还是先来回顾一下我们是如何用编程的方式去加载MyBatis框架的String resource = "mybatis/conf/mybatis-config.xml"; InputStream inpu
转载 2024-04-11 10:28:54
41阅读
# 如何在Python中写JSON到文件 ## 概述 在Python中,我们可以使用`json`模块将数据转换为JSON格式并写入文件。本文将介绍如何实现这个过程,并指导刚入行的小白完成这个任务。 ## 流程 首先我们来看整个过程的步骤: | 步骤 | 操作 | | --- | --- | | 1 | 导入`json`模块 | | 2 | 创建要写入的数据 | | 3 | 将数据转换为JSO
原创 2024-07-03 04:14:45
45阅读
  什么是本地缓存                本地缓存是一种数据存储技术,它将数据暂时存储在本地的物理内存(如RAM)或者其他快速访问的存储介质中,以便快速检索,减少对远程数据源(如数据库或外部API)的访问需求。这种技术能够
转载 2024-10-23 10:50:20
47阅读
# Python 元素写到元组的实现方法 ## 介绍 在Python中,元组是一种不可变的数据类型,它可以存储多个元素,并且元素的值是不可更改的。有时候我们需要将一些数据写入元组中,这篇文章将会介绍如何实现将Python元素写入元组的方法。 ## 实现步骤 下面是实现将Python元素写入元组的步骤的表格形式展示: | 步骤 | 描述 | |---|---| | 步骤1 | 创建一个空元
原创 2024-01-25 08:17:38
76阅读
# Python矩阵写到Excel:自动化数据记录与分析 在数据分析和处理领域,Python 是一种非常流行的编程语言,它提供了许多强大的库来处理数据。当我们需要将矩阵数据写入 Excel 文件时,Python 的 `pandas` 和 `openpyxl` 库可以大大简化这一过程。本文将介绍如何使用 Python 将矩阵数据写入 Excel,并进行一些基本的数据处理。 ## 环境准备 首先
原创 2024-07-29 08:12:58
67阅读
# Python中的多变量写入数组 在Python中,我们经常需要将多个变量存储到一个数组中,以便统一管理和处理这些数据。本文将介绍如何在Python中实现多变量写入数组的操作,以及一些实际应用场景。 ## 为什么需要将多变量写入数组? 在日常编程中,我们常常会遇到需要处理多个相关变量的情况。例如,我们可能需要同时保存一个人的姓名、年龄和性别等信息。如果将这些变量分开存储,会导致代码重复和可
原创 2024-07-05 04:29:27
31阅读
# 如何在Python写到文件的末尾 ## 1. 介绍 作为一名经验丰富的开发者,我将教你如何在Python中将内容写入文件的末尾。这对于在文件中添加新内容非常有用,特别是当你需要追加数据而不是覆盖原有内容时。 ## 2. 流程 下面是实现这一目标的步骤: | 步骤 | 操作 | |------|------| | 1 | 打开文件 | | 2 | 将光标移动到文件末尾 | | 3 | 写
原创 2024-03-20 06:54:46
267阅读
# Python Protobuf写入文件的实现 ## 概述 本文将向你展示如何使用Python Protobuf库将数据写入文件中。首先,我们将介绍整个过程的流程,然后逐步说明每一步需要做什么,并提供相应的代码。 ## 整体流程 下面是实现“Python Protobuf写入文件”的整体流程: ```mermaid pie "定义Protobuf消息结构" : 40 "将消
原创 2023-10-29 10:07:42
325阅读
一、import的用法介绍   第一种:导入模块:import 包名.模块名                          调用函数:包名.模块名。函数名(参数) 第二种:导入模块:from&
  • 1
  • 2
  • 3
  • 4
  • 5